Rotary Cutting Tool Selection: Key Factors to Review

Choosing the appropriate rotary cutting tool for a particular task involves careful consideration of multiple aspects. Material type is essential; denser materials often demand stronger end mills with higher carbide grade. Number of flutes greatly impacts chip evacuation and surface finish , with more flutes generally yielding a finer finish but potentially affecting load on the cutter . Finally , the needed depth of cut and feed speed need to be carefully aligned with the end mill's characteristics .
